WebMix your Milk Paint to achieve your desired look. Start with 1 part powder to 1 part water and adjust from there. If you want more of a textured finish, we recommend mixing it a little thicker and chunky, and don’t smooth it out so much. We mixed roughly 1 part water with two parts Palm Springs Pink Fusion Milk Paint Powder for this wall.
